How To Fix LS_SHP019 - Please fill in all the required fields


SAP Error Message - Details

  • Message type: E = Error

  • Message class: LS_SHP - Message Class for LE_SHP Apps

  • Message number: 019

  • Message text: Please fill in all the required fields

    The SAP error message LS_SHP019, which states "Please fill in all the required fields," typically occurs in the context of logistics and shipping processes within the SAP system. This error indicates that certain mandatory fields in a transaction or document are not filled out, preventing the process from proceeding.

    Cause:

    The error can be triggered by several factors, including:

    1. Missing Mandatory Fields: Certain fields in the shipping or delivery document are required but have not been filled in. This could include fields like delivery date, shipping point, or other relevant data.

    2. Configuration Issues: The system may be configured in such a way that additional fields are marked as mandatory, which may not be obvious to the user.

    3. User Input Errors: Users may overlook required fields or enter data in an incorrect format.

    4. Custom Enhancements: If there are custom developments or enhancements in the SAP system, they may impose additional requirements that are not standard.

    Solution:

    To resolve the LS_SHP019 error, follow these steps:

    1. Identify Missing Fields: Review the transaction screen to identify which fields are highlighted or marked as mandatory. These fields usually have asterisks (*) next to them.

    2. Fill in Required Information: Ensure that all mandatory fields are filled in with the correct data. This may include:

      • Delivery date
      • Shipping point
      • Item details
      • Quantity
      • Customer information
    3. Check Configuration: If you suspect that the error is due to configuration, consult with your SAP administrator or functional consultant to review the settings for the relevant module (e.g., Sales and Distribution, Materials Management).

    4. Review Custom Enhancements: If there are custom enhancements in place, check with the development team to understand any additional requirements that may have been implemented.

    5. Consult Documentation: Refer to SAP documentation or help files for specific guidance on the transaction you are working with.

    6. Testing: After making the necessary changes, attempt to save or process the transaction again to see if the error persists.

    Related Information:

    • Transaction Codes: The error may occur in various transaction codes related to shipping and delivery, such as VL01N (Create Outbound Delivery), VL02N (Change Outbound Delivery), or others.
